Under the leadership of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, the Cabinet Committee on Economic Affairs (CCEA) has given the green light to three crucial rail multi-tracking projects. These initiatives include the construction of the third and fourth lines at Nagdamathura, Guntkalwadi, and Budhwal Sitapur, with a total investment of approximately ₹23,437 crores.
The CCEA highlighted that these projects will enhance the operational efficiency of the railways, increase train speeds, and reduce congestion. Additionally, this initiative aligns with Prime Minister Modi's vision of a 'New India' by promoting regional development, which is expected to create more job and self-employment opportunities.
These projects are part of the PM Gati Shakti National Master Plan, aimed at improving multimodal connectivity and logistics efficiency. The network will extend across 19 districts in Madhya Pradesh, Rajasthan, Uttar Pradesh, Karnataka, Andhra Pradesh, and Telangana, increasing the Indian railway network by 901 kilometers.
The proposed projects will enhance connectivity for approximately 4,161 villages, benefiting a population of around 8.3 million. These tracks will improve train services to major pilgrimage sites such as Mahakaleshwar, Ranthambore, Kuno, Keoladeo National Park, Mathura, Vrindavan, and other significant destinations.
According to the railway authorities, these projects will boost freight capacity by an additional 60 million tons per year, covering coal, grains, cement, POL, iron, and containers. Furthermore, this environmentally friendly and energy-efficient transportation method is projected to reduce CO2 emissions by 1.85 billion kilograms, equivalent to planting approximately 70 million trees.
The expansion of the rail network is set to not only enhance trade and logistics but also create new employment opportunities. This initiative is crucial for environmental conservation and improving connectivity.
